-// Copyright 2013 The Chromium Authors. All rights reserved.
-// Use of this source code is governed by a BSD-style license that can be
-// found in the LICENSE file.
-//
-// Implementation of NtMapViewOfSection intercept for 32 bit builds.
-//
-// TODO(robertshield): Implement the 64 bit intercept.
-
-#include "chrome_elf/blacklist/blacklist_interceptions.h"
-
-#include <string>
-#include <vector>
-
-// Note that only #includes from base that are either header-only or built into
-// base_static (see base/base.gyp) are allowed here.
-#include "base/basictypes.h"
-#include "base/strings/string16.h"
-#include "base/win/pe_image.h"
-#include "chrome_elf/blacklist/blacklist.h"
-#include "sandbox/win/src/internal_types.h"
-#include "sandbox/win/src/nt_internals.h"
-#include "sandbox/win/src/sandbox_nt_util.h"
-#include "sandbox/win/src/sandbox_types.h"
-
-namespace {
-
-NtQuerySectionFunction g_nt_query_section_func = NULL;
-NtQueryVirtualMemoryFunction g_nt_query_virtual_memory_func = NULL;
-NtUnmapViewOfSectionFunction g_nt_unmap_view_of_section_func = NULL;
-
-// TODO(robertshield): Merge with ntdll exports cache.
-FARPROC GetNtDllExportByName(const char* export_name) {
- HMODULE ntdll = ::GetModuleHandle(sandbox::kNtdllName);
- return ::GetProcAddress(ntdll, export_name);
-}
-
-bool DllMatch(const string16& module_name) {
- for (int i = 0; i < blacklist::g_troublesome_dlls_cur_index; ++i) {
- if (module_name == blacklist::g_troublesome_dlls[i])
- return true;
- }
- return false;
-}
-
-// TODO(robertshield): Some of the helper functions below overlap somewhat with
-// code in sandbox_nt_util.cc. See if they can be unified.
-
-// Native reimplementation of PSAPIs GetMappedFileName.
-string16 GetBackingModuleFilePath(PVOID address) {
- DCHECK_NT(g_nt_query_virtual_memory_func);
-
- // We'll start with something close to max_path characters for the name.
- ULONG buffer_bytes = MAX_PATH * 2;
- std::vector<BYTE> buffer_data(buffer_bytes);
-
- for (;;) {
- MEMORY_SECTION_NAME* section_name =
- reinterpret_cast<MEMORY_SECTION_NAME*>(&buffer_data[0]);
-
- if (!section_name)
- break;
-
- ULONG returned_bytes;
- NTSTATUS ret = g_nt_query_virtual_memory_func(
- NtCurrentProcess, address, MemorySectionName, section_name,
- buffer_bytes, &returned_bytes);
-
- if (STATUS_BUFFER_OVERFLOW == ret) {
- // Retry the call with the given buffer size.
- buffer_bytes = returned_bytes + 1;
- buffer_data.resize(buffer_bytes);
- section_name = NULL;
- continue;
- }
- if (!NT_SUCCESS(ret))
- break;
-
- UNICODE_STRING* section_string =
- reinterpret_cast<UNICODE_STRING*>(section_name);
- return string16(section_string->Buffer,
- section_string->Length / sizeof(wchar_t));
- }
-
- return string16();
-}
-
-bool IsModuleValidImageSection(HANDLE section,
- PVOID *base,
- PLARGE_INTEGER offset,
- PSIZE_T view_size) {
- DCHECK_NT(g_nt_query_section_func);
-
- if (!section || !base || !view_size || offset)
- return false;
-
- SECTION_BASIC_INFORMATION basic_info;
- SIZE_T bytes_returned;
- NTSTATUS ret = g_nt_query_section_func(section, SectionBasicInformation,
- &basic_info, sizeof(basic_info),
- &bytes_returned);
-
- if (!NT_SUCCESS(ret) || sizeof(basic_info) != bytes_returned)
- return false;
-
- if (!(basic_info.Attributes & SEC_IMAGE))
- return false;
-
- return true;
-}
-
-string16 ExtractLoadedModuleName(const string16& module_path) {
- if (module_path.empty() || module_path[module_path.size() - 1] == L'\\')
- return string16();
-
- size_t sep = module_path.find_last_of(L'\\');
- if (sep == string16::npos)
- return module_path;
- else
- return module_path.substr(sep+1);
-}
-
-// Fills |out_name| with the image name from the given |pe| image and |flags|
-// with additional info about the image.
-void SafeGetImageInfo(const base::win::PEImage& pe,
- std::string* out_name,
- uint32* flags) {
- out_name->clear();
- out_name->reserve(MAX_PATH);
- *flags = 0;
- __try {
- if (pe.VerifyMagic()) {
- *flags |= sandbox::MODULE_IS_PE_IMAGE;
-
- PIMAGE_EXPORT_DIRECTORY exports = pe.GetExportDirectory();
- if (exports) {
- char* image_name = reinterpret_cast<char*>(pe.RVAToAddr(exports->Name));
- size_t i = 0;
- for (; i < MAX_PATH && *image_name; ++i, ++image_name)
- out_name->push_back(*image_name);
- }
-
- PIMAGE_NT_HEADERS headers = pe.GetNTHeaders();
- if (headers) {
- if (headers->OptionalHeader.AddressOfEntryPoint)
- *flags |= sandbox::MODULE_HAS_ENTRY_POINT;
- if (headers->OptionalHeader.SizeOfCode)
- *flags |= sandbox::MODULE_HAS_CODE;
- }
- }
- } __except(GetExceptionCode() == EXCEPTION_ACCESS_VIOLATION ?
- EXCEPTION_EXECUTE_HANDLER : EXCEPTION_CONTINUE_SEARCH) {
- out_name->clear();
- }
-}
-
-string16 GetImageInfoFromLoadedModule(HMODULE module, uint32* flags) {
- std::string out_name;
- base::win::PEImage pe(module);
- SafeGetImageInfo(pe, &out_name, flags);
- return string16(out_name.begin(), out_name.end());
-}
-
-} // namespace
-
-namespace blacklist {
-
-bool InitializeInterceptImports() {
- g_nt_query_section_func = reinterpret_cast<NtQuerySectionFunction>(
- GetNtDllExportByName("NtQuerySection"));
- g_nt_query_virtual_memory_func =
- reinterpret_cast<NtQueryVirtualMemoryFunction>(
- GetNtDllExportByName("NtQueryVirtualMemory"));
- g_nt_unmap_view_of_section_func =
- reinterpret_cast<NtUnmapViewOfSectionFunction>(
- GetNtDllExportByName("NtUnmapViewOfSection"));
-
- return g_nt_query_section_func && g_nt_query_virtual_memory_func &&
- g_nt_unmap_view_of_section_func;
-}
-
-SANDBOX_INTERCEPT NTSTATUS WINAPI BlNtMapViewOfSection(
- NtMapViewOfSectionFunction orig_MapViewOfSection,
- HANDLE section,
- HANDLE process,
- PVOID *base,
- ULONG_PTR zero_bits,
- SIZE_T commit_size,
- PLARGE_INTEGER offset,
- PSIZE_T view_size,
- SECTION_INHERIT inherit,
- ULONG allocation_type,
- ULONG protect) {
- NTSTATUS ret = orig_MapViewOfSection(section, process, base, zero_bits,
- commit_size, offset, view_size, inherit,
- allocation_type, protect);
-
- if (!NT_SUCCESS(ret) || !sandbox::IsSameProcess(process) ||
- !IsModuleValidImageSection(section, base, offset, view_size)) {
- return ret;
- }
-
- HMODULE module = reinterpret_cast<HMODULE>(*base);
- if (module) {
- UINT image_flags;
-
- string16 module_name(GetImageInfoFromLoadedModule(
- reinterpret_cast<HMODULE>(*base), &image_flags));
- string16 file_name(GetBackingModuleFilePath(*base));
-
- if (module_name.empty() && (image_flags & sandbox::MODULE_HAS_CODE)) {
- // If the module has no exports we retrieve the module name from the
- // full path of the mapped section.
- module_name = ExtractLoadedModuleName(file_name);
- }
-
- if (!module_name.empty() && DllMatch(module_name)) {
- DCHECK_NT(g_nt_unmap_view_of_section_func);
- g_nt_unmap_view_of_section_func(process, *base);
- ret = STATUS_UNSUCCESSFUL;
- }
-
- }
- return ret;
-}
-
-} // namespace blacklist
